(The Boy, the Mole, the Fox and the Horse) serves as a profound "reset". Rather than a complex narrative, the text is a collection of conversations between four unlikely friends wandering through a wild landscape. Through their journey, Mackesy explores the internal landscape of the human heart, suggesting that the true "home" we seek is not a physical location, but a state of being found in love, vulnerability, and connection. This is not a traditional novel with a linear plot, but rather a series of ink-drawn illustrations accompanied by handwritten dialogue. It follows four unlikely friends—a lonely boy, a cake-loving mole, a wary fox, and a wise horse—as they journey together in search of a home. (The Boy, the Mole, the Fox and the
